Moving Pallet Racking Beams Compromises Load Capacity

Making alterations to pallet racking techniques, such as changing beam heights or removing parts, can have a big influence on load capability and compromise the protection of the system. Even seemingly minor changes may end up in a drastic discount in load-bearing capabilities. Here are key factors to contemplate:

Bottom Brace Removal:

Removing the underside brace of a pallet racking system can lead to a de-rating of the entire system's load capability.

Innocent actions, corresponding to eradicating braces to store non-palletized objects, can have main security implications.

Effect of Beam Pitch Changes:

Altering beam pitch, even moderately, can substantially affect load capacity.

For example, raising the beam pitch from 600mm to 3750mm can lead to an 80% discount in load capability.

Impact on Load Capacities:

Small modifications in beam pitch, similar to raising it to facilitate a doorway, can result in a 50% reduction in load capacity.

Even changes from 600mm to 2400mm may end up in a major reduction in maximum load capability.

Changes in beam pitch impact the laws of physics governing upright stress and cargo distribution.

Removing the bottom beams with out correct assessment can compromise the protection of the complete racking system.

Consultation with Original Designer:

Before making any changes to a pallet racking system, it is essential to consult with the unique designer or installer.

Easy clip racking techniques may contribute to the issue, emphasizing the need for skilled consultation.

Effective Signage:

Displaying effective racking signage indicating most load levels for each bay is necessary.

Signs have to be up to date with each change to reflect correct load capacities and safety concerns.

Regular System Checks:

Regularly checking and updating the racking system in coordination with the original installer is essential.

Minor modifications might have been carried out with out assessing the implications, and it's important to rectify any potential compromises.
